Special Consideration

Special Consideration is a post examination adjustment to a candidate’s mark or grade to reflect temporary injury, illness or other indisposition at the time of the examination/assessment. The Special Consideration application can only be submitted by the college to an awarding body once the circumstances are verified and evidenced. If a student has concerns that their performance in an exam has been affected for any of the reasons specified they are invited to discuss their circumstances with their Personal Mentor in the first instance. Applications can only be submitted once an examination has taken place and the deadline for submission to the Examinations team will be published for each exam season and information can also be sought by contacting the Examination team directly via email.

A Special Consideration application can only be submitted once the exam date has passed and the Special Consideration application submission deadline  02 July 2025

 Certificates

Certificates are not immediately available after the summer results have been published. Awarding bodies send them to the college by early November and then they are checked for accuracy before being made available for collection. Students will receive an email to advise when the collection window opens.

Lost Certificates

If you have lost your certificates the college is unable to help you with  getting replacements. You will need to contact the awarding body yourself to request a ‘statement of results’.
